Generative Bionics, an Italian humanoid robotic developer, raised €70 million ($81.2 million) in funding. The corporate mentioned the brand new funding will assist it develop its product, practice bodily AI techniques, and assemble its first manufacturing plant. Generative Bionics mentioned additionally it is finalizing its first industrial deployment contracts, which it is going to announce in early 2026.
The firm plans to unveil the whole model of its first humanoid at CES in Las Vegas.

Generative Bionics is constructing on greater than 20 years of analysis, improvement, and prototyping of humanoids at IIT. The corporate spun out of IIT in 2024. IIT has granted the corporate unique licenses to key applied sciences.
The funding spherical was led by the Synthetic Intelligence Fund of CDP Enterprise Capital. It included participation from AMD Ventures, Duferco, Eni Subsequent, RoboIT, and Tether.

Generative Bionics’ humanoids are constructed on applied sciences developed in IIT’s main robotics applications. This contains iCub, a cognitive analysis robotic; ergoCub, the humanoid co-developed with INAIL to assist staff in industrial settings; and iRonCub, a flying humanoid.
From this basis, the corporate has outlined three technological pillars for its humanoids:
- A distributed community of tactile and pressure sensors, derived from iCub, enabling protected bodily interplay
- A Bodily AI structure, refined via ergoCub, permitting humanoids to be designed for particular purposes and to be taught straight from actual environments
- Superior AI strategies, developed with iRonCub, enabling adaptation to excessive operational circumstances akin to excessive temperatures or complicated out of doors environments
Humanoids start becoming a member of the workforce
For the previous few years, humanoids have dominated conversations in robotics. Each week, new humanoid firms are popping up around the globe, and established firms are bringing in giant funding rounds.
For instance, Agility Robotics as we speak introduced its newest Digit deployment. Mercado Libre, a number one commerce and fintech ecosystem in Latin America, is integrating Digit right into a facility in San Antonio, Texas. The businesses didn’t present many particulars about what the robotic will do on the facility.
Digit was first deployed with GXO in June 2024. That is extensively thought of to be the primary deployment of a humanoid at a business buyer web site.
Whereas Agility could also be main the way in which in deployments to date, Determine AI leads in funding. In September 2025, the corporate closed its Sequence C funding spherical. With the spherical, it surpassed $1 billion in dedicated capital, bringing its post-money valuation to $39 billion. Determine has deployed its robots with a paying buyer since December 2024.
Each Agility and Determine are American firms. In Europe, Generative Bionics will face competitors from Humanoid, a U.Ok.-based developer that launched its first humanoid earlier this month. Moreover, Agile Robots, a German developer, unveiled its humanoid Agile ONE in November.
